The median Insight Analyst salary in England is £45,000 per year, according to job vacancies posted during the 6 months leading to 13 June 2024.

The table below provides salary benchmarking and summary statistics, comparing them to the same period in the previous two years.

6 months to
13 Jun 2024
Same period 2023 Same period 2022
Rank 778 598 1019
Rank change year-on-year -180 +421 -227
Permanent jobs requiring an Insight Analyst 85 313 167
As % of all permanent jobs advertised in England 0.089% 0.38% 0.12%
As % of the Job Titles category 0.094% 0.42% 0.12%
Number of salaries quoted 56 122 89
10th Percentile £31,549 £32,759 £31,663
25th Percentile £40,750 £35,500 £32,500
Median annual salary (50th Percentile) £45,000 £38,875 £42,500
Median % change year-on-year +15.76% -8.53% +2.69%
75th Percentile £60,000 £48,938 £52,500
90th Percentile £64,875 £59,236 £63,150
UK median annual salary £45,000 £39,000 £42,500
% change year-on-year +15.38% -8.24% +6.25%
